Errington Primary school is an average sized primary school based in Marske who is proud to be part of the Tees Valley Collaborative Trust. We pride ourselves on inclusion and provide vibrant learning experiences for all of our pupils.

We are seeking to appoint an enthusiastic and talented Level 2 Teaching Assistant with a 1:1 responsibility for supervising a child with additional needs who has the vision and drive to make a significant impact in school and is committed to making a difference to the lives of our children.

The successful candidate will work alongside the class teacher to supervise specific pupils with additional needs, as well as supporting all aspects of teaching and learning within a classroom. You will be engage and nurture all pupils within the classroom, whilst providing specific support for a pupil with specific learning needs. You will also communicate effectively with the teaching team to provide bespoke and careful teaching sequences that allow all pupils to succeed.

You must be Level 2 NVQ qualified, experience with working with children with specific learning needs and have experience of working with children in a primary school setting from reception to Year 6.

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
